You can only really do Julia's Theme if someone's getting a happy ending (Jean and Stacey Slater) or if someone is a big character (Pat Evans and Peggy Mitchell).
Tanya didn't have a happy ending, considering she'd lost everything, and wasn't that big of a character in all honesty. |

Jean IMO got the Julia's theme as she'd been through such a journey during her time in Walford that it was rather fitting with her LONG OVERDUE happy ending.
We've followed Jean from those days living in her boarded up house being terrorised by neighbours, many highs, lows, selfless acts and for the actress, remarkable portrayal of her condition, BUT, not only that, portraying the character of Jean, a PERSON who just so happens to be a bipolar sufferer as opposed to a bipolar sufferer, called Jean. Gillian/Jean, never really did her condition define her, it was just a part of the person she was. Fitting end to a bloody brilliant character/actress.
